Career path

Career Role Description
Biomedical Engineer (Validation) Develops and implements validation strategies for biomedical devices and equipment, ensuring regulatory compliance and product safety. High demand due to increased medical device innovation in the UK.
Regulatory Affairs Specialist (Biomedical) Manages regulatory submissions and ensures compliance with UK and EU regulations for biomedical products. Crucial for product launch and market access.
Quality Assurance Engineer (Biomedical) Oversees quality control processes throughout the lifecycle of biomedical devices, including validation activities. Essential for maintaining high product quality standards.
Clinical Engineering Specialist Focuses on the safe and effective use of medical technology within healthcare settings. Plays a key role in equipment validation and maintenance.
